This was the first year I've participated, and I'm proud to say I had 53,000 odd words by November 30th! This entitles me to the cool winner stamp you see above and allows me to purchase a cool winners t-shirt, and also print a certificate which I can do with as I please. NaNoWriMo is completely non-profit, so any money spent on their site goes to maintaining the site and continuing the writing programs they offer to schools.If you're a writer or want to be a writer, I encourage you to check them out and maybe next year take the challenge. They say it's not about the winning, it's about feeling the accomplishment of just trying, but frankly, I like the winning. ;)
